Paragraph t162.p16 (line(s) 225-227) Click line no. for paragraph-aligned layout of transliteration and translation.
The weapon, its heart ……, was reassured: it slapped its thighs, the Šar-ur began to run, it entered the rebel lands, joyfully it reported the message to Lord Ninurta:
